China’s aluminum wire & cable exports rise in Sep

According to statistics released by the General Administration of Customs of the People's Republic of China, China exported 19,500 tons of aluminum wires and cables in September, rising by 22.4% from the same month a year ago.

In the first three quarters of this year, the exports reached approximately 183,000 tons, growing by 18.72% compared to the same period a year earlier.
